    HVAC Maintenance Company in Dubai, UAE: A Commercial Building Perspective

    HVAC Maintenance Company in Dubai, UAE: A Commercial Building Perspective

    Executive Summary For facility managers, asset owners, and procurement teams in Dubai, selecting an HVAC maintenance company is a critical operational decision impacting OPEX, asset lifecycle, and business continuity. This guide provides a technical framework for evaluating HVAC maintenance strategies, focusing on the specific environmental and regulatory demands of the UAE. It compares preventive vs. reactive models, outlines key deliverables for a commercial HVAC provider, and quantifies the financial impact of structured maintenance. The objective is to equip decision-makers with the operational reasoning and risk-based analysis needed to optimize HVAC performance, ensure compliance, and protect long-term asset value in Dubai's challenging commercial property market. The Role of HVAC Systems in Commercial & Institutional Buildings In Dubai's competitive commercial real estate sector, HVAC systems are not merely utilities for comfort; they are core operational assets directly influencing financial performance and tenant retention. An engineering-led perspective treats HVAC not as an expense item but as a critical system with measurable impacts on several key business metrics. Energy Consumption: HVAC systems are a primary driver of operational expenditure (OPEX). In UAE conditions, they can represent 35–50% of a commercial building's total energy consumption. Inefficient or poorly maintained systems directly inflate DEWA utility costs, eroding net operating income. Indoor Air Quality (IAQ): The system's function extends beyond temperature control to air filtration and ventilation. Inadequate maintenance can lead to the circulation of contaminants, affecting occupant health and productivity, and potentially violating Dubai Municipality regulations. Tenant Satisfaction: Consistent thermal comfort and reliable cooling are non-negotiable expectations for commercial tenants. Frequent breakdowns, hot spots, or poor air quality are leading drivers of complaints and can negatively impact lease renewals. Business Continuity Impact: For mission-critical facilities like data centres, hospitals, or high-value retail, an HVAC system failure is not an inconvenience but a significant operational event. Such failures can halt operations, result in data or inventory loss, and cause substantial financial and reputational damage. Effective HVAC management is, therefore, a strategic component of asset management, directly linked to OPEX control, risk mitigation, and the overall commercial viability of the property. Why HVAC Systems Fail Frequently in Dubai Commercial HVAC systems in Dubai operate under some of the most demanding environmental conditions globally. Failures are rarely random events; they are typically the cumulative result of intense, predictable stressors. Understanding these failure modes is fundamental to developing an effective preventive planning strategy. Extreme Heat Load Stress: With ambient summer temperatures frequently exceeding 45–50°C, HVAC systems run at near-maximum capacity for extended periods. This sustained high-load operation places immense strain on critical components, particularly compressors, leading to accelerated wear, lubricant degradation, and premature mechanical failure. Coil Contamination from Sand/Dust: Airborne particulate matter, primarily sand and dust, is a primary cause of inefficiency and failure. This dust loading clogs condenser coils, severely impeding the system's ability to reject heat. This forces the compressor to work harder, increasing energy consumption and raising system pressures to dangerous levels, which can lead to catastrophic failure. Condensate Drain Blockages: High humidity cycles produce significant volumes of condensate. If drain lines are not regularly flushed, they become blocked by biological growth and accumulated sludge. This often results in water overflow, causing significant interior water damage, ceiling collapse, and costly rectification works. Deferred Maintenance Culture: A common operational gap in the UAE market is the deferral of scheduled maintenance to reduce short-term costs. This approach allows minor issues—like failing capacitors or low refrigerant levels—to cascade into major system breakdowns, resulting in higher lifecycle costs. Compressor Strain: The combination of high heat load, contaminated coils, and potential refrigerant imbalances places continuous strain on compressors. This is the single most common cause of high-cost, high-disruption failures in the region. Oversized/Undersized System Issues: Incorrectly specified systems from the design phase can lead to chronic operational problems. Oversized units cycle too frequently, failing to dehumidify the air properly, while undersized units run constantly without achieving setpoints, leading to premature burnout. Preventive HVAC Maintenance vs Breakdown Repairs The decision between a planned preventive maintenance strategy and a reactive, breakdown-driven model is a choice between managed risk and unmanaged liability. This choice fundamentally dictates OPEX predictability, asset lifecycle costs, and operational stability. Reactive repairs—addressing failures as they occur—may appear to offer lower upfront costs but introduce significant financial and operational volatility. This approach exposes the asset to emergency call-out premiums, unplanned downtime, and accelerated equipment degradation. A structured preventive maintenance program, executed by a qualified HVAC maintenance company in Dubai, UAE, is a risk mitigation strategy designed to identify and rectify faults before they escalate into system failures. Comparison Table: Preventive Maintenance vs Reactive Repairs This framework contrasts the operational and financial outcomes of a structured preventive maintenance contract against a reactive, breakdown-only service approach for a commercial facility in Dubai. Metric Preventive Maintenance Model (AMC) Reactive Repair Model (Breakdown Only) Total Cost of Ownership (TCO) Lower. Achieved through reduced major repairs, optimized energy use, and extended asset lifespan. Higher. Driven by premium emergency labour rates, accelerated component failure, and premature capital replacement. Budget Predictability (OPEX) High. Fixed contract costs allow for accurate operational budgeting and financial forecasting. Low. Costs are unpredictable and volatile, leading to significant budget variances and unplanned expenditures. Energy Efficiency (DEWA Costs) Optimized. Regular coil cleaning, refrigerant calibration, and component checks ensure operation at peak efficiency. Poor. Degraded performance from dust loading and system imbalances leads to sustained higher energy consumption. Asset Lifecycle Extended. Proactive care mitigates operational stress, potentially extending equipment life by 20-30%. Shortened. Repeated stress cycles and catastrophic failures drastically reduce the functional lifespan of the equipment. Tenant Complaint Risk Low. High system reliability and consistent performance lead to improved tenant satisfaction and retention. High. Frequent system failures are a primary source of tenant complaints, negatively impacting building reputation. Business Disruption Minimal. Maintenance is scheduled during off-peak hours to avoid impacting core business operations. Significant. Unplanned failures often occur during peak hours, causing maximum disruption to tenants and operations.     A Technical Guide: How Much Does It Cost to Maintain a Villa in Dubai?

    A Technical Guide: How Much Does It Cost to Maintain a Villa in Dubai?

    For asset owners and facility managers, the operational expenditure (OPEX) for maintaining a villa in Dubai typically ranges between 1% and 2% of the property's total value annually. This benchmark is a critical input for financial forecasting, lifecycle asset management, and ensuring sustained portfolio value. This guide provides a technical breakdown of these costs, comparing maintenance models and offering a decision framework for optimising OPEX without compromising asset integrity or regulatory compliance. A Practical Breakdown of Villa Maintenance Costs To accurately forecast the cost of maintaining a villa in Dubai, one must analyse the constituent parts of the total OPEX, which includes planned preventive maintenance, reactive rectification works, utilities, and mandatory community fees. Effective budgeting requires a granular understanding of each cost driver. For property and facility managers overseeing a portfolio, financial clarity is a primary operational requirement. The table below provides an estimated annual cost breakdown for a standard 3-5 bedroom villa, serving as a high-level framework for OPEX forecasting. Estimated Annual Maintenance OPEX for a Standard Dubai Villa This table provides a typical cost breakdown for maintaining a standard 3-5 bedroom villa, helping asset owners and facility managers forecast operational expenditures. Service Category Average Annual Cost Range (AED) Key Operational Drivers Annual Maintenance Contracts (AMC) 1,500 – 15,000 Scope of work (labour-only vs comprehensive), asset criticality, SLA response times. Utilities (DEWA) 40,000 – 70,000 HVAC efficiency, irrigation system controls, occupancy patterns, DEWA tariff structure. Landscaping & Pool Maintenance 12,000 – 30,000 Garden size, irrigation automation, plant types, pool size and equipment condition. Specialised Services & Cleaning 5,000 – 20,000 Pest control frequency, facade cleaning, water tank cleaning, deep cleaning schedules. Mandatory Community Service Charges 15,000 – 35,000 Community tier, common area amenities, DLD Service Charge Index, developer policies. This data illustrates that while an AMC is a visible cost, it often represents a smaller fraction of the total financial commitment required for compliant and effective property operation. As the infographic indicates, the maintenance contract is a component of a much larger operational budget required to manage the asset effectively. Industry data confirms this. For a standard three-bedroom villa valued between AED 3-5 million, the total annual maintenance expenditure typically falls between AED 70,000 and AED 100,000. This aligns with the 2% OPEX benchmark. This figure is distributed across key cost centres that every facility manager must plan for. For instance, a basic Annual Maintenance Contract (AMC) may range from AED 1,500 to AED 6,000 annually, often covering emergency call-outs and baseline system checks with limited scope. Decoding Core Hard FM Costs Like HVAC and MEP While soft services contribute to the asset's aesthetic and habitability, it is the 'hard' facilities management (FM) services that constitute the operational core and present the most significant financial variable in the maintenance budget. These are the critical HVAC (Heating, Ventilation, and Air Conditioning) and MEP (Mechanical, Electrical, and Plumbing) systems. Mismanagement of these assets leads to escalated OPEX and premature asset failure. In Dubai, the primary catalyst for accelerated degradation is the climate. The combination of sustained high temperatures, high humidity cycles, and significant airborne dust loading places extreme stress on mechanical and electrical systems. This environment accelerates component wear, reduces operational efficiency, and shortens the asset lifecycle unless mitigated by a structured preventive maintenance plan. HVAC Systems: The Dominant Cost Centre Within any Dubai villa's hard FM budget, the HVAC system is the dominant cost centre, primarily through its impact on electricity consumption. Operating almost continuously for 8-9 months of the year, it is the logical focus for both cost control and operational risk management. A reactive "fix-on-fail" methodology is an operationally unsound and financially punitive approach. An emergency call-out for a critical AC failure during peak summer months incurs premium labour charges, introduces the risk of secondary asset damage, and guarantees significant occupant discomfort. Proactive maintenance is the only logical risk mitigation strategy. Industry practice often shows that the cost of an emergency HVAC compressor replacement can be 5 to 10 times higher than the annual cost of a preventive maintenance plan designed to identify and rectify precursor faults. A robust HVAC maintenance plan is based on several key preventive activities, each with direct cost implications: Quarterly Filter Cleaning/Replacement: Essential for maintaining required airflow and indoor air quality. Obstructed filters increase system load and can elevate energy consumption by 5-15%. Bi-Annual Coil and Condenser Cleaning: Dust and biofilm accumulation on coils acts as an insulator, severely impairing the system's heat exchange efficiency. Annual System Health Check: A comprehensive technical inspection covering refrigerant levels, electrical connections, and thermostat calibration to ensure operational parameters are within design specifications. For a typical villa, a dedicated annual maintenance plan for the HVAC system will generally fall between AED 2,000 and AED 5,000, contingent on the number and type of units. This is not an expense but a strategic investment in OPEX control and asset lifecycle extension. Analysing MEP and Utility Expenditures Beyond HVAC, the remaining MEP systems and associated utility consumption represent a significant and often underestimated financial commitment. A detailed understanding of DEWA's tariff structure is essential for effective cost management. These costs are substantial. Annual utility bills can easily reach AED 20,000-30,000, with specialised electrical or plumbing rectification works adding thousands more. DEWA’s slab tariff structure is the primary driver. For residential consumers, the electricity rate begins at AED 0.23/kWh for the first 2,000 kWh but increases to AED 0.38/kWh above 6,000 kWh (plus a fuel surcharge). This tiered system means operational inefficiency incurs costs at an accelerated rate. A comprehensive maintenance strategy targets key points of failure before they escalate into high-cost emergencies: Plumbing: Regular inspections of water pumps, booster sets, and tanks are vital to prevent costly leaks and catastrophic failures in water pressure.     IT AMC in Dubai: Why Every Office Needs Technical Support Under an Annual Contract

    IT AMC in Dubai: Why Every Office Needs Technical Support Under an Annual Contract

    Do you ever worry about your office computers crashing unexpectedly? Or perhaps you’re concerned about data security and the hassle of IT problems disrupting your workday? In Dubai’s fast-paced business world, technology is the backbone of every successful operation. But what happens when that backbone starts to ache? Many businesses in Dubai face constant IT challenges. These range from slow networks and software glitches to serious cybersecurity threats. Often, they wait for something to break before calling for help. This “break-fix” approach might seem cheaper at first, but it can lead to huge costs in lost productivity, data loss, and unexpected repair bills. There is a better way, one that many smart businesses in Dubai are already using. This approach is called an IT Annual Maintenance Contract, or IT AMC. It’s a proactive solution designed to keep your IT systems running smoothly, securely, and efficiently. Let’s explore why every office in Dubai, big or small, needs this kind of technical support. What is an IT AMC in Dubai, and Why Do Businesses Need It? An IT Annual Maintenance Contract (AMC) is like having a dedicated health plan for all your office technology. Instead of waiting for a computer to fail or a network issue to cripple your operations, an AMC provider offers ongoing, proactive support. This usually includes regular check-ups, maintenance, and quick solutions for any IT problem that comes up. In Dubai, businesses operate in a highly competitive and digitally advanced environment. Downtime, even for a few hours, can mean losing customers, missing deadlines, and damaging your reputation. Imagine your point-of-sale system going down during a busy shopping festival, or critical files becoming inaccessible right before a big client meeting. These scenarios highlight the real cost of neglecting your IT infrastructure. The unique challenges in Dubai include rapid technological adoption, a diverse workforce, and strict data security requirements. An IT AMC helps you navigate these complexities. It ensures your systems are always up-to-date, protected from threats, and compliant with local regulations. It moves you from reacting to problems to preventing them. Why Your Dubai Office Needs Proactive IT Support: The Benefits of an Annual Contract Switching to an IT AMC offers numerous advantages that go far beyond just fixing broken computers. Here are some key benefits for your Dubai office: Cost Predictability: Say goodbye to unexpected repair bills. With an IT AMC, you pay a fixed monthly or annual fee. This makes budgeting for IT expenses much easier and helps you avoid sudden financial shocks. Reduced Downtime: Proactive maintenance means your IT provider regularly monitors your systems, identifying and fixing potential issues before they cause major disruptions. Less downtime means more productivity for your team. Expert Access: You gain access to a team of experienced IT professionals without having to hire full-time staff. This is especially beneficial for small and medium-sized businesses that might not have the budget for an in-house IT department. Enhanced Cybersecurity: Cyber threats are growing. An AMC often includes security updates, firewall management, and antivirus solutions. This strengthens your defenses against ransomware, phishing, and data breaches, protecting your valuable information. Compliance & Regulations: Dubai has specific regulations regarding data handling and business operations. A good IT AMC provider can help ensure your systems comply with these standards, avoiding potential penalties. Scalability: As your business grows, your IT needs change. An AMC allows your IT support to scale up or down with your requirements. This flexibility ensures your technology always matches your business growth. Focus on Core Business: When IT issues are handled by experts, your team can focus on what they do best – running and growing your business. No more wasting time troubleshooting computer problems. IT AMC vs. Break-Fix: Understanding the Difference for Your Dubai Business The traditional “break-fix” model means you only call an IT technician when something goes wrong. It’s like only going to the doctor when you’re seriously ill. This approach has many downsides for a modern business in Dubai. With break-fix, costs are unpredictable. A server crash can lead to a massive bill for emergency repairs and data recovery. Furthermore, the focus is always on reaction, not prevention. This means systems often run inefficiently, security vulnerabilities might go unnoticed, and small problems can escalate into big ones. An IT AMC, on the other hand, is proactive. Your provider regularly checks your systems, installs updates, monitors network performance, and looks for potential issues before they happen. This preventative approach saves you money in the long run by avoiding costly emergencies and minimizing downtime. It ensures your IT infrastructure is robust, secure, and always performing optimally, which is crucial for business continuity.
